Types of Luxury Hotel Jobs

The luxury hospitality sector offers diverse career paths across multiple departments. Front office roles include guest relations managers, concierge staff, and reception specialists who serve as the first point of contact for guests. Food and beverage positions range from sommeliers and head chefs to restaurant managers and banquet coordinators. Housekeeping departments employ executive housekeepers, room attendants, and quality control supervisors who ensure impeccable standards. Sales and marketing teams focus on brand positioning, corporate partnerships, and event management. Spa and wellness centers require therapists, fitness instructors, and wellness consultants. Behind-the-scenes roles include human resources specialists, finance managers, procurement officers, and engineering staff who maintain the property’s infrastructure and systems.

Luxury Resort Job Opportunities

Dubai’s luxury resort sector extends beyond traditional hotel settings to include beachfront properties, desert retreats, and integrated entertainment complexes. These environments offer unique career opportunities that combine hospitality with recreation management, environmental stewardship, and cultural programming. Resort positions often involve coordinating outdoor activities, managing water sports facilities, organizing cultural experiences, and overseeing children’s programs. Many resorts emphasize sustainability practices, creating roles focused on environmental management and community engagement. The resort environment typically offers a more relaxed atmosphere compared to urban hotels, though service standards remain equally demanding. Professionals working in resorts often enjoy accommodation benefits, access to facilities, and opportunities to work in scenic locations that attract international clientele.

Securing a position in Dubai’s luxury hospitality sector involves understanding the recruitment landscape and preparing accordingly. International candidates typically require employment visas sponsored by their employers, which necessitates meeting specific qualification and experience requirements. Application processes often include multiple interview stages, practical assessments, and background checks. Researching potential employers, understanding their brand values, and demonstrating alignment with their service philosophy strengthens applications. Professional presentation, cultural awareness, and genuine passion for hospitality are essential qualities that recruiters seek. Many properties recruit through specialized hospitality recruitment agencies, online job platforms, and career fairs. Building a strong professional profile, maintaining updated credentials, and cultivating references from previous employers enhance candidacy. Patience and persistence are important, as securing positions in prestigious properties can be competitive and time-intensive.
